[Xerte-dev] Re: Too many places with duplicate code, and I lost track....

Tom Reijnders reijnders at tor.nl
Mon Feb 18 11:47:22 GMT 2013


I'll yet to fix It for now. Will clean It up later...

Julian Tenney <Julian.Tenney at nottingham.ac.uk> schreef:

>It should be, yes, and agree, we should tidy it up at some point,
>
>-----Original Message-----
>From: xerte-dev-bounces at lists.nottingham.ac.uk
>[mailto:xerte-dev-bounces at lists.nottingham.ac.uk] On Behalf Of Pat @
>Pgogy
>Sent: 18 February 2013 09:20
>To: For Xerte technical developers
>Subject: [Xerte-dev] Re: Too many places with duplicate code, and I
>lost track....
>
>Hello,
>
>I think, but am not sure, that only one set of the files is exported
>now. The code in the modules folder mirrors the desktop XOT export.
>This part of the code is a bit confused.
>
>Pop up should be in all three though
>
>Pgogy Webstuff - http://www.pgogywebstuff.com Makers of web things of a
>fair to middling quality
>
>On 18 Feb 2013, at 08:00, Tom Reijnders <reijnders at tor.nl> wrote:
>
>> I've got a problem with a xot installation and a scorm export.
>> 
>> This particular RLO is using the embedDiv model, and it works fine if
>you publish it from XOT, but exported to SCORM (can't test normal
>export yet, need user credentials first), it doesn't work.
>> 
>> As far as I can tell now, it's because the embedDiv tries to call
>resizePopup, but that doesn't exit in scormRLO.htm. As far as I can
>tell it doen's exist in modules/xerte/player/RLOobject.htm (used for a
>normal export) either, and I think it should.
>> 
>> A lot of code that is in the rlo object is duplicated.
>> 
>> There is a rloObject.js in the root of xerte that is similar but
>different than the rloObject.js used for export. There is popupCode in
>play.php, and in scromRLO.htm, rloObject.htm, scorm2004.htm, but the
>latter 3 miss some functions that are in player.php.
>> 
>> At some point in time we should clean this up. For now, Am I correct
>that resizePopup should be in scromRLO.htm, rloObject.htm,
>scorm2004.htm?
>> 
>> Tnx,
>> 
>> Tom
>> 
>> --
>> --
>> 
>> Tom Reijnders
>> TOR Informatica
>> Chopinlaan 27
>> 5242HM Rosmalen
>> Tel: 073 5226191
>> Fax: 073 5226196
>> 
>> 
>> _______________________________________________
>> Xerte-dev mailing list
>> Xerte-dev at lists.nottingham.ac.uk
>> http://lists.nottingham.ac.uk/mailman/listinfo/xerte-dev
>> This message and any attachment are intended solely for the addressee
>and may contain confidential information. If you have received this
>message in error, please send it back to me, and immediately delete it.
>Please do not use, copy or disclose the information contained in this
>message or in any attachment.  Any views or opinions expressed by the
>author of this email do not necessarily reflect the views of the
>University of Nottingham.
>> 
>> This message has been checked for viruses but the contents of an 
>> attachment may still contain software viruses which could damage your
>computer system:
>> you are advised to perform your own checks. Email communications with
>
>> the University of Nottingham may be monitored as permitted by UK
>legislation.
>
>_______________________________________________
>Xerte-dev mailing list
>Xerte-dev at lists.nottingham.ac.uk
>http://lists.nottingham.ac.uk/mailman/listinfo/xerte-dev
>
>_______________________________________________
>Xerte-dev mailing list
>Xerte-dev at lists.nottingham.ac.uk
>http://lists.nottingham.ac.uk/mailman/listinfo/xerte-dev
>This message and any attachment are intended solely for the addressee
>and may contain confidential information. If you have received this
>message in error, please send it back to me, and immediately delete it.
>Please do not use, copy or disclose the information contained in this
>message or in any attachment.  Any views or opinions expressed by the
>author of this email do not necessarily reflect the views of the
>University of Nottingham.
>
>This message has been checked for viruses but the contents of an
>attachment
>may still contain software viruses which could damage your computer
>system:
>you are advised to perform your own checks. Email communications with
>the
>University of Nottingham may be monitored as permitted by UK
>legislation.

-- 
Verzonden van mijn Android telefoon met K-9 Mail.
-------------- next part --------------
An HTML attachment was scrubbed...
URL: <http://lists.nottingham.ac.uk/pipermail/xerte-dev/attachments/20130218/2d956a50/attachment.html>


More information about the Xerte-dev mailing list